What is Chroming? Understanding Inhalant Abuse Trends

Chroming is a term you might not hear every day, but it’s crucial to understand what it really means! In simple terms, chroming involves inhaling chemical vapors from products like aerosol sprays, paint, and glue to achieve a quick intoxication effect. It’s often seen in younger individuals looking for a cheap thrill, but the dangers of chroming can be severe and long-lasting.

Why is this happening? You might ask. Well, the ease of access to these household items makes it tempting for many, especially teens who might be looking for excitement or a way to escape reality. But, here’s a fun fact: while it may seem harmless, the reality is far from it! The trend of chroming has been rising alarmingly, with reports indicating that many young people are experimenting with it. Can you believe that?

The allure of chroming is all about that quick buzz, but it comes at a hefty price. Users are often not aware of the immediate and long-term consequences. Inhalants can lead to significant cognitive impairments and serious health risks such as heart failure, respiratory issues, and even sudden death! The Dangers of Chroming: Health Risks and Consequences

Chroming isn’t just a harmless trend; it comes with some serious health risks that can affect both the body and mind. Think about inhaling household products like aerosol deodorants or glues. Sounds innocent, right? Not quite! When people engage in chroming, they are exposing themselves to toxic chemicals that can lead to devastating consequences.

One of the most alarming effects of chroming is the potential for brain damage. Your brain is your body’s command center, and when it gets hit with these harmful substances, the results can be disastrous. Ever heard of sudden sniffing death syndrome? It’s a real thing, and it can happen even to first-time users. Isn’t that shocking? This syndrome happens when a person experiences a fatal cardiac arrhythmia after inhaling these volatile substances.

But wait, it doesn’t end there! Long-term chroming can harm multiple organs, including your liver, kidneys, and lungs. Just think about how hard it is for your body to process these toxic chemicals! With repetitive use, it’s like putting your health on the back burner. How can you enjoy life when your body is constantly fighting against itself?

Apart from physical repercussions, the psychological effects of chroming can be equally devastating. Users may experience mood swings, irritability, or even full-blown hallucinations. Imagine battling not just your cravings but also your mental state! This can create a vicious cycle where the individual feels more isolated and depressed, leading them back to the very substances they seek to escape from.

Signs and Symptoms of Chroming Abuse You Should Know

Recognizing the signs and symptoms of chroming abuse is crucial for early intervention and support. Unlike other substances, the effects of inhalant abuse can be quite sneaky, often slipping under the radar. Keep an eye out for changes in behavior and physical appearance because these can be significant indicators.

Some common signs of chroming might include sudden mood swings, irritability, or even a lack of interest in activities they once loved. Have you noticed someone becoming unusually secretive or spending excessive time in their room? These shifts can point toward potential inhalant use. It’s essential to pay attention not just to what they say, but also how they act.

  • Red or runny eyes
  • Confusion or dizziness
  • Unusual chemical odors on their breath or clothes
  • Changes in appetite or sleep patterns
  • Frequent nosebleeds

Other physical signs that you shouldn’t overlook could include red or runny eyes and a sudden change in appetite or sleep patterns. Did you know that some users might experience frequent nosebleeds as a direct result of their inhalant use? It’s shocking but true! Effective Treatment Options for Inhalant Abuse Recovery

Recovering from chroming isn’t just about stopping the use of inhalants; it’s about rebuilding a life that’s been affected by addiction. Fortunately, there are several effective treatment options available for individuals struggling with inhalant abuse. Don’t you just love the thought of reconnecting with your true self and breaking free from those chains of dependency?

Therapy is a fantastic starting point! Both individual and group therapy can help individuals explore the underlying issues driving their addiction. With a trained professional, one can unveil the emotions tied to their behavior and create new coping strategies. Plus, group therapy provides a support network—how amazing is it to know you’re not alone in this fight?

Next up, consider cognitive behavioral therapy (CBT). This approach focuses on changing negative thought patterns that can lead to substance abuse. CBT encourages positive thinking and helps individuals set realistic goals for their recovery. It’s like having a personal coach cheering you on as you learn to manage cravings and triggers!

In some cases, medication can also play a role in recovery. While there are no specific medications approved for chroming addiction, certain medications might help manage withdrawal symptoms and reduce cravings. Always consult a healthcare provider to find the best options tailored to individual needs.

Support groups, such as 12-step programs, have proven to be lifesavers for many. They create a sense of community, offering a place to share experiences, struggles, and victories. Who wouldn’t feel uplifted by a supportive bunch of people who get it?
